Star Jasper (born December 3, 1966) is an American actress.

Early life and education[edit]

Jasper was born in Brooklyn. Her father, Leonard Jasper, was a New York City developer. Her mother, Marion Ellner, a fine artist, has retired to Panama.

Star graduated from Long Island University.[1] She studied acting at Richmond College in London and at Lee Strasberg Theatre and Film Institute in New York City.

Career[edit]

She has appeared in a number of films including True Love, Jersey Girl, Pushing Tin, Mortal Thoughts and A Walk on the Moon. She has many television credits to her name, including Law & Order, Brooklyn South, Murder One, and Diagnosis Murder.

Personal life[edit]

Jasper is married to Chris Seefried, musician and singer in the rock band Gods Child. She currently resides in Los Angeles.
